What about a critique? Is that any different?
celandinestern
celandinestern on Oct 15 '09 at 5:06pm
yes. I could never bring myself to do it, even if it wasn't frowned upon... I don't do it even in critiques, although there it's more or less accepted as ok. I just feel if I tack on 'now look at mine please' at the end of my comment, it comes off as if I'm not interested in the piece I'm looking at, but only in self-promotion. And that really takes any possible meaning out of my comment.
celandinestern
celandinestern on Oct 15 '09 at 5:07pm
in critiques it's kinda ok because there aren't that many people that even visit the critique section, so sometimes you just get zero response if you don't pimp it around a bit. As I said, I still can't really bring myself to do it.
